McCain contradictions

Wasn't McCain's release from imprisonment a result of negotiations (whether openly or secretly conducted)? Not only negotiations, but negotiations during an active war with the government holding him prisoner! Does he now say that given the chance he would have requested that the U.S. government not conduct such negotiations directly or indirectly? Would he refuse to negotiate the release or exchange of prisoners now?

The "pass" being given McCain by the media I think has something to do with wanting not to be hard on someone who has suffered imprisonment and torture. While that is a nice policy, when the person enters public life and attempts to reach a position of power, it is a duty to hold the person to whatever standards other campaigners are held. Now, there may be problems with the standards in use regarding others (see for example the treatment of Obama in the Obama-Clinton-ABC debate), but all that means is that if changes are needed to be humane to McCain, then they must be applied to all.
